Xolo Era 2X with 5-Inch Display and Fingerprint Sensor Launched at Rs. 6,666

Xolo has officially launched its Era 2X smartphone in Indian market on Thursday. The new budget smartphone supports 4G VoLTE and can thus be used to avail Reliance Jio Happy New Year offer. It will be exclusively available on Flipkart from January 9 onwards. The Xolo Era 2X price starts at Rs. 6,666. The Era 2X will be available in black gunmetal and latte gold color options.

Xolo continues to focus on the entry segment, and that’s what the Era 2X design clearly reflects. The Xolo Era 2X flaunts an all-plastic exterior with a rear-mounted fingerprint sensor. It isn’t a shoddy phone, but befitting to its price, it isn’t a premium Android either.

The fingerprint sensor can register up to 5 fingers. Apart from securing the device, a user can assign different tasks to each one of the stored fingerprints like tap to snap an image, launch an app or perhaps receive calls.

The Era 2X features a 5-inch HD IPS display and enthralls on a 1.25GHz quad-core MediaTek chipset coupled with 2GB/3GB RAM and 16GB internal memory. However, to buy 3GB RAM variant one will have to shell out Rs. 7,499.

The Era 2X camera optics include an 8-megapixel primary shooter with f/2.0 aperture, 5P Largon lens, blue glass filter and single LED flash. The rear camera can also record time-lapse videos. Up front, the phone sports a conventional 5-megpaixel selfie snapper.

On the software front, the Era 2X comes out of the box running on Android Marshmallow OS. The phone is aided by a 2,500mAh removable battery which, as per the company claims, can offer up to 14 days of standby time on single charge.

Xolo Era 2X Specifications and Features

Model Xolo Era 2X
Display 5-Inch, HD IPS Oncell display
Processor 1.25 GHz MediaTek 64-bit Quad-Core Processor
RAM 2GB/3GB
Internal Storage 16GB
Software Android Marshmallow 6.0
Primary Camera 8 MP Auto-Focus Rear Camera with 5P Largan Lens
Secondary Camera 5 MP Front Camera
Weight
Battery 2500mAh removable battery
Others 4G VoLTE, Dual SIM, WiFi, Bluetooth, GPS, 3.5mm
Price Rs. 6,666/7,499
